How Recent Bitcoin Trends Affect Investors' Profits
The digital currency sphere has been a whirlwind of change, especially with Bitcoin—the pioneering cryptocurrency. As Bitcoin continues to capture global attention, its price swings and market trends are crucial for investors aiming to maximize their profits. Here, we dissect the recent trends in Bitcoin and their effects on investors.
The Fluctuating Landscape
Bitcoin’s price is notoriously volatile, and recent trends have been no exception. The market has experienced significant highs and lows, often influenced by external factors ranging from regulatory changes to technological advancements. These fluctuations can be both a boon and a bane for investors. For instance, Bitcoin’s price saw an impressive surge in late 2020 and early 2021, reaching unprecedented heights. This period attracted numerous newcomers to the cryptocurrency space, driven by the prospect of substantial profits.
However, the euphoria was short-lived as Bitcoin faced a sharp decline in 2021, dipping to levels not seen in a year. This volatility underscores the importance of understanding market trends to make informed decisions. For seasoned investors, these trends provide opportunities to buy low and sell high, while for newcomers, they highlight the necessity of careful research and risk management.
Institutional Adoption
A major trend reshaping Bitcoin's market dynamics is the increasing interest from institutional investors. Companies like Tesla, MicroStrategy, and Square have made headlines by purchasing Bitcoin as part of their treasury assets. This institutional adoption has injected a new level of legitimacy and stability into Bitcoin, which in turn attracts more retail investors.
For individual investors, this trend is a double-edged sword. On one hand, it signals growing acceptance and potential for long-term appreciation. On the other hand, it also means that Bitcoin's price can be more heavily influenced by institutional decisions, which can sometimes lead to abrupt market movements.
Regulatory Developments
Regulatory frameworks play a pivotal role in Bitcoin’s price trends. Governments worldwide are grappling with how to classify and regulate cryptocurrencies. In some countries, favorable regulations have boosted Bitcoin’s appeal, while in others, stringent rules have imposed limitations.
For example, the increasing acceptance in countries like El Salvador, which adopted Bitcoin as legal tender, has had a positive ripple effect on its value. Conversely, countries with restrictive regulations have seen a corresponding drop in Bitcoin prices. Investors need to stay updated on these regulatory changes as they directly impact Bitcoin’s market value and investor sentiment.
Technological Advancements
The underlying technology of Bitcoin, the blockchain, continues to evolve, impacting its market trends. Innovations like the Lightning Network aim to address Bitcoin’s scalability issues, potentially leading to a more efficient and faster transaction system. Such technological improvements are crucial for Bitcoin’s long-term viability and can drive up its value.
For investors, staying abreast of technological advancements is essential. Innovations can lead to increased adoption and greater utility, which in turn can boost Bitcoin’s price. However, they can also introduce new risks if not properly understood and managed.
Market Sentiment
Market sentiment, driven by news, social media, and broader economic trends, plays a significant role in Bitcoin’s price movements. Positive news, such as endorsements by influential figures or favorable regulatory news, can drive prices up, while negative news can cause prices to plummet.
Understanding market sentiment is key for investors. Tools like social media analytics can provide insights into the collective mood of the market, helping investors gauge potential price movements. However, it’s important to remember that market sentiment can be irrational at times, and not all news should be taken at face value.
Diversification and Risk Management
One of the most crucial aspects of investing in Bitcoin is diversification and risk management. Given Bitcoin’s volatility, holding a diversified portfolio can mitigate risks. This doesn’t necessarily mean spreading investments across different cryptocurrencies; it could involve balancing between Bitcoin and other asset classes like stocks, bonds, and commodities.
Additionally, risk management strategies such as setting stop-loss orders and dollar-cost averaging can help investors protect their investments. These strategies allow investors to limit potential losses and take advantage of market trends without being overly reactive to short-term price movements.
